-
Notifications
You must be signed in to change notification settings - Fork 4
Expand file tree
/
Copy pathbuild.config.msm.vienna.le
More file actions
30 lines (26 loc) · 1.1 KB
/
build.config.msm.vienna.le
File metadata and controls
30 lines (26 loc) · 1.1 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
################################################################################
## Inheriting configs from ACK
. "${KERNEL_DIR}/build.config.constants"
ARCH=arm64
LLVM=1
CLANG_PREBUILT_BIN=prebuilts/clang/host/linux-x86/clang-${CLANG_VERSION}/bin
BUILDTOOLS_PREBUILT_BIN=build/kernel/build-tools/path/linux-x86
#################################################################################
## Target and Variant setup
MSM_ARCH=vienna_le
VARIANTS=(defconfig debug-defconfig)
[ -z "${VARIANT}" ] && VARIANT=debug-defconfig
[ -n "${VARIANT}" ] && ! [[ " ${VARIANTS[*]} " =~ ${VARIANT} ]] && echo "Error: Invalid VARIANT specified" && exit 1
ABL_SRC=bootable/bootloader/edk2
BOOT_IMAGE_HEADER_VERSION=2
BASE_ADDRESS=0x80000000
PAGE_SIZE=4096
BUILD_BOOT_IMG=1
DTB_IMG_CREATE=1
PREFERRED_USERSPACE=le
SKIP_UNPACKING_RAMDISK=1
[ -z "${DT_OVERLAY_SUPPORT}" ] && DT_OVERLAY_SUPPORT=0
if [ "${KERNEL_CMDLINE_CONSOLE_AUTO}" != "0" ]; then
KERNEL_CMDLINE+=' console=ttyMSM0,115200n8 earlycon=qcom_geni,0xa90000 qcom_geni_serial.con_enabled=1 loglevel=8 rootwait init=/sbin/init '
fi
KERNEL_VENDOR_CMDLINE+=' bootconfig '